PTP/ST 2059 Made Easy

Synopsis:
Genlock with analogue black was easy. You just plugged your analog black reference coax cable into the plug labelled genlock and it worked. You had 2 SPGs and 1 ACO and your master reference was done. Easy peasy and hard to get wrong. PTP/2059 adds a lot of flexibility and unfortunately this allows you to do it wrong. Some early implementations did it wrong and had issues. This has created some bad feelings in the industry towards PTP/ST 2059. This presentation will cover some easy to follow PTP/ST 2059 best practices that will ensure a successful PTP/ST 2059 deployment.
Presenter:

Leigh Whitcomb has 30+ years of experience in the broadcast industry from his time working at Imagine Communications, and Meinberg. He participates in SMPTE, Alliance for IP Media Solutions (AIMS), Institute of Electrical and Electronics Engineers (IEEE), and Video Services Forum (VSF) standards committees, including serving as the co-chair of SMPTE 32NF Network/Facilities Architecture Technology Committee. He is actively involved in SMPTE ST 2110 Professional Media over Managed IP Networks and SMPTE ST 2059 Genlock Over IP. He became a SMPTE Fellow in 2017. His other professional affiliations include Professional Engineers Ontario. He holds a bachelor’s degree in computer engineering from the University of Waterloo, ON, Canada, and a master’s degree in electrical and computer engineering from the University of Toronto, ON, Canada. He is the co-inventor of several patents in the areas of networking and timing and synchronization.
